Product reviews:
Griffith
2025-03-20 iphone 7
Kestrel Talon Tri Shimano 105 Road Bike kestrel talon tri shimano 105
kestrel talon tri shimano 105
Harvey
2025-03-19 iphone Xs
TALON X - SHIMANO 105 TRI kestrel talon tri shimano 105
kestrel talon tri shimano 105
Gregary
2025-03-20 iphone 11
Kestrel Talon X Tri Shimano 105 2018 kestrel talon tri shimano 105
kestrel talon tri shimano 105